Temperature profile data collected from BT and XBT casts in the Northwest Atlantic Ocean from 1982-11-09 to 1982-11-15 (NCEI Accession 8600192)
Temperature profile data were collected using BT and XBT casts from the OCEANUS in the Northwest Atlantic Ocean. Data were collected from 09 November 1982 to 15 November 1982 by US Geological Survey (USGS) with support from the Outer Continental Shelf - Georges Bank (OCS - Georges Bank) project. Data has been processed by NODC to the NODC standard Bathythermograph (XBT) (C116) format. The C116/C118 format contains temperature-depth profile data obtained using expendable bathythermograph (XBT) instruments. Cruise information, position, date and time were reported for each observation. The data record was comprised of pairs of temperature-depth values. Unlike the MBT Data File, in which temperature values were recorded at uniform 5 m intervals, the XBT data files contained temperature values at non-uniform depths. These depths were recorded at the minimum number of points ("inflection points") required to accurately define the temperature curve. Standard XBTs can obtain profiles to depths of either 450 or 760 m. With special instruments, measurements can be obtained to 1830 m. Prior to July 1994, XBT data were routinely processed to one of these standard types. XBT data are now processed and loaded directly in to the NODC Ocean Profile Data Base (OPDB). Historic data from these two data types were loaded into the OPDB.

This record contains Sofar float (subsurface drifter) data collected during the GUSREX (GUlf Stream Recirculation EXperiment) in the Northern Atlantic. There were 41 deployments from April 30 to December 31, 1980. The data was collected over a period of 6 years from April 30, 1980 to April 24, 1986. The floats were deployed at 700 and 2000 m depths. Additional parameters measured were temperature and pressure. These data were submitted by Dr. Phil Richardson, Woods Hole Oceanographic Institution (WHOI). The data is currently available in the C116 Bathythermograph file format of NODC.
